Morse Micro MM61xx SoC Family

The IEEE 802.11ah Wi-Fi HaLow standard defines a sub-1-GHz implementation of Wi-Fi that provides longer operating range while sacrificing throughput. Morse Micro’s MM61xx family is designed to provide low-power, Wi-Fi HaLow support to a host using an SPI/SDIO interface. The MM6104 works with single streams up to 15 Mb/s while the MM6108 can handle data rates up to 32.5 Mb/s. Both interact with the host using an SPI/SDIO serial interface. They have options for UART and I2C communication plus GPIO and PWM support as well.

Rockwell Automation Allen‑Bradley GuardLink 2.0 Ethernet/IP Module

The GuardLink 2.0 Ethernet/IP module from Rockwell Automation comes outfitted with Allen‑Bradley’s 432ES GuardLink EtherNet/IP On-Machine Interface. The module ca M be combined with the company’s GuardLink Relay and EtherNet/IP Interface. The GuardLink 2.0 protocol provides safety-rated control device status and automatic diagnostic reporting to an HMI using CIP Safety (integrated safety services) over EtherNet/IP.

Texas Instruments CC2340R5

The CC2340R5 starts at just $0.79 per 1,000 units by extending battery life with a standby current of <700 nA, maximizing design flexibility with up to 512 kB of flash memory, and expanding RF performance with an output power range of +8 dBm. The reduction in standby current helps extend battery life for up to 10 years on a coin-cell battery in wireless applications such as electronic shelf labels and tire pressure monitoring systems.
